
Preparing Your Commercial Roof for Hurricane Season
As hurricane season approaches, staying ahead of severe weather is essential for the safety and integrity of your property. With 17 to 24 named storms predicted this season, including 8 to 13 hurricanes, it’s crucial to ensure your commercial roof can withstand the challenges that hurricanes bring.
Inspect Your Roof Thoroughly
The first step to protect your roof is to conduct a detailed inspection. Document any potential vulnerabilities with photos and notes, especially regarding existing defects. Knowing the type of roof system and its installation date can help you understand the necessary preventive measures. Contact your manufacturer for warranty details and ensure you have the right coverage with your insurance broker, as this can save you money in the event of damage.
Regular Maintenance Matters
Preventive maintenance is key to minimizing roof damage. Regular housekeeping inside and outside your facility will help. Remove debris and unsecured items from your roof, as they can turn into dangerous projectiles during a storm. Clear gutters and drains to prevent water accumulation, and check that all equipment, like HVAC units and satellite dishes, are secured. Meeting with a reliable roofing contractor can also ensure that in an emergency, help is readily available. Ask about their process for handling severe weather responses.
